Make: German Mauser
Model: Commercial Variation of a K98.
Serial Number: None
Year of Manufacture: Pre-1939
Caliber: 8mm Mauser (8x57mm)
Action Type: Bolt Action, Internal Magazine
Markings: The receiver, claw mounts, and bolt handle are marked with decorative metal work. The rifle’s remaining markings are under the wood. The bottom of the receiver is marked with several inspection stamps which include several “X” stamps, “G”, and “B”. The barrel shank is marked with a German pre 1939 “crown / N” proof, with a “crown” proof, “7,9m/m”, “K” and with few other small stampings.
Barrel Length: Approximately 23 ½ Inches
Sights / Optics: The front sight is a beaded blade set atop a ramped base. The base is part of a full length rib. The 3 leaf rear sight is made up of one stationary and 2 flip up “U” notched leaves. The top edge of the stationary leaf is marked “100”. The rear leaf is marked “150” and the front leaf is marked “200”. The rear sight is dovetail set into the rib. Two claw mounts are dovetail set into the receiver. These are quick release claw mounts. The spring loaded lock in the rear claw mount is released when the sides are pulled to the rear.
